General Manager
Location: Southlake, TX
Employment Type: Full-Time
Compensation: $75,000 - $95,000 (Based on Experience) + Revenue & Profitability Bonuses

Energize a young, high-potential custom glass company in the Dallas-Fort Worth area that's outgrowing its current setup. As General Manager, you'll be the field-driven leader who hits the pavement daily, coordinating projects hands-on, managing teams on-site, and keeping operations smooth to crush inefficiencies and fuel rapid growth. Forget the desk job. This is for action-oriented pros specializing in shower doors, mirrors, windows, and custom installs, delivering top-tier service to homeowners, contractors, and businesses while staying in the mix. While P&L support is available internally, you'll focus on driving daily execution and team momentum.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ead from the front: Hands-on coaching for our small team of installers, fabricators, and support staff. Tackle issues in real-time on job sites to build momentum and squash productivity roadblocks like disjointed project flow.
  • Command project coordination: Allocate resources, hit timelines, trim costs, and step in directly to keep every install on track, easing the load on internal project management.
  • Own daily ops in the field: Troubleshoot challenges as they arise, streamline workflows from quote to close-out, and roll out practical fixes to ditch outdated processes.
  • Forge client and vendor ties on the move, network locally to snag deals and open doors.
  • Monitor budgets and KPIs while out in the field; support lean tweaks for better margins with internal P&L guidance.
  • Champion safety, quality, and compliance every step of the way.
Qualifications

  • 5-10 years in sales, operations, or project management (glass, construction, or home services), with proven hands-on team leadership.
  • Strong daily ops know-how for small teams: Focus on execution, timelines, and efficiency in fast-paced environments (P&L experience helpful but not required).
  • Street-smart project coordination: Excel at getting in the trenches to deliver on time and under budget, fixing problems proactively rather than from afar.
  • Sharp communication to rally teams, charm clients, and sync partners, all while engaging on-site.
  • Familiarity with project tools, business software, and Microsoft Office.
  • Valid driver's license and ready for local travel (this role lives on the road).
  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Management, or equivalent hustle (preferred).
  • Must pass background check and drug test.
Benefits

  • Health and dental insurance.
  • Paid time off (PTO).
